#eb356e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#eb356e is composed of 92.2% red, 20.8% green and 43.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 77.4% magenta, 53.2% yellow and 7.8% black. It has a hue angle of 341.2 degrees, a saturation of 82% and a lightness of 56.5%. #eb356e color hex could be obtained by blending #ff6adc with #d70000. Closest websafe color is: #ff3366.

#eb356e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#eb356e has RGB values of R:235, G:53, B:110 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.77, Y:0.53, K:0.08. Its decimal value is 15414638.
